Your plant looks very nice. Without looking at a closeup of the trichomes, my guess would be a minimum of 2 - 3 more weeks. I still see many white pistils. They put on a lot of bulk and bud density in final few weeks.

Your plants are about where I start looking at the trichomes expecting several more weeks before harvest. I am not versed in outdoor so my advice may not hit the mark.
